Brodsky Squash Pavilion
The Kate Brodsky Memorial Squash Pavilion is located on the third floor of the Pizzitola Sports Center. Kate Brodsky '89, a nationally ranked squash player at Brown, passed away in her freshman year.
The Brodsky Pavilion, named in her honor, houses five international glass-back squash courts, bleacher seating for up to 200 spectators, and individual court scoreboards. Brown University and the Brodsky Pavilion hosted the finals of the US Open in 1994 and 1995, respectively, and were won by Peter Nicol and Jansher Khan.
In 2010, the Brodsky Squash Pavilion underwent a $200,000 facelift. New competition surfaces, bleacher seating, environmental graphics, and a lounge area were constructed in the pavilion.
